Default NP 244 AWD transfer case opinions/questions

I am currently looking at purchasing an amazingly clean near spotless 2004 Ram QC laramie......but its equiped with AWD NP244 transfer case. You can go from AWD to 4wd lock and 4wd low. Can everyone with or without this option please chime in and tell me your opinions on it!?

Does this affect fuel economy?
How about tires wearing faster?
Does the truck drive different?
If you own one do you like it?

Other than that this truck has 110,000 miles and is immaculate. Its a laramie with the 20's, leather, navigation, the works. Not a mark on it. He is looking to get 13,600 for it.

Fuel Economy won't be as good as if it was 2wd w/ 4-lock and 4-low...

Tire wear shouldn't be too much worse, but will depend on your driving habits.

Yes the truck will oversteer much less and you will get less power to the ground overall.

Don't own an AWD Ram, just a regular 4x4.

If it's in good condition and you like it and the price is right then you might as well buy it.
